Compare Daly City to Seal Beach

This post compares Daly City, California to Seal Beach,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Daly City (city) Seal Beach (city)
Population 106,480 24,510
Income (median) $47,397 $76,405
Home Value (median) $651,600 $338,100
White 21% 80%
Black 3% 1%
Asian 57% 10%
With Kids 31% 13%
Age (median) 39 58
Rentals 43% 24%
